Kuwait accepts a new administration amidst political unrest.

Kuwait's Emir, Sheikh Meshal al-Ahmed al-Sabah, has granted approval to a new cabinet, marking a significant development in the midst of a political crisis. This move comes just two days after the dissolution of the recently elected parliament, with the emir and the new government assuming certain powers previously held by the assembly. Citing "interference" by lawmakers, the emir dissolved the parliament, considered one of the most powerful elected legislatures in the Gulf, and suspended articles of the constitution.

The newly formed government, Kuwait's 46th, is led by Prime Minister Sheikh Ahmed al-Abdullah al-Sabah and comprises 13 ministers, including two women. The former oil minister was tasked with forming the government following the dissolution of the National Assembly, which had been elected just two weeks prior. The outgoing premier, Sheikh Mohammad Sabah al-Salem al-Sabah, declined to resume his post amid ongoing tensions between the government and the 50-member National Assembly.

Kuwait's political landscape has long been characterized by a tug-of-war between the government and the ruling family on one side and the Islamist-dominated opposition on the other. In the most recent election held in early April, the opposition once again secured a majority in parliament, maintaining their grip on power. Allegations of corruption against ministers and accusations of hindering development plans by the legislature have fueled tensions, resulting in persistent deadlock and delaying much-needed reforms in the oil-rich Gulf state.

This decision to dissolve the parliament marks the second such move by Sheikh Meshal al-Ahmed al-Sabah since assuming the role of emir in December, following the death of his half-brother and predecessor, Sheikh Nawaf al-Ahmed al-Jaber al-Sabah. The political turmoil in Kuwait reflects broader challenges faced by the country as it navigates internal power struggles and seeks to address pressing socio-economic issues amid a rapidly changing regional landscape.
